Detalles del Curso
• Fundamentals of Electric Aircraft Navigation Systems: Understanding the basics of electric aircraft navigation systems, including components, functions, and their importance in modern aviation.
• Electrical Systems for Electric Aircraft: An in-depth look at the electrical systems that power navigation and other critical functions in electric aircraft.
• Navigation Sensors and Data Processing: Exploring the various sensors and data processing techniques used in electric aircraft navigation systems.
• Communication and Surveillance Systems: Examining the communication and surveillance systems used in electric aircraft navigation, including Automatic Dependent Surveillance-Broadcast (ADS-B) and Traffic Collision Avoidance Systems (TCAS).
• Autopilot and Flight Control Systems: Understanding the autopilot and flight control systems used in electric aircraft navigation, including their design, implementation, and testing.
• Navigation Display Systems: Learning about the navigation display systems used in electric aircraft, including their design, functionality, and limitations.
• Airspace and Procedures for Electric Aircraft Navigation: Examining the airspace and procedures for electric aircraft navigation, including the differences between traditional and electric aircraft navigation.
• Safety and Security in Electric Aircraft Navigation: Exploring the safety and security considerations for electric aircraft navigation systems, including redundancy, fault tolerance, and cybersecurity.
• Emerging Trends and Future Developments in Electric Aircraft Navigation: Investigating the emerging trends and future developments in electric aircraft navigation systems, including electric vertical takeoff and landing (eVTOL) aircraft and urban air mobility (UAM).
